Roofings nearby 150 Loveday Street Braamfontein Johannesburg 2001, Klerksdorp, 2001, South Africa

DGB Construction (Pty) Ltd

Approximately 0.72 km away
Address: 27 Edith Cavell Street, Johannesburg, 2001, South Africa

AWA Awnings

Approximately 1.4 km away
Address: Johannesburg, South Africa

Sun Construction ,Roofing and Maintenance Contractors

Approximately 1.4 km away
Address: Pietermaritzburg, South Africa